Walking a fine line between Instagram censorship and provocativeness, Berlin photographer Marius Sperlich uses the human figure as a canvas to style tiny props that tell a larger story.
“I am using body parts in my work, but the stories I am telling are not about the body itself. The stories are about what is happening on and around it,” he told Playboy in 2018.
Currently, he’s working on a life-like Statue of Liberty turned Kim Kardashian sculpture with Joachim Bosse.
